#712589 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#712589 is composed of 44.3% red, 14.5%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.5% cyan, 73%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 285.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 34.1%. #712589 color hex could be obtained by blending #e24aff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#712589 color description : Dark magenta.

The hexadecimal color #712589 has RGB values of R:113, G:37,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 7415177.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b040d is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#59545a is the less saturated color, while #8204aa is the most saturated one.
